Since I wrote this post, I found a “dizziness neurologist” who diagnosed me with both VM and PPPD plus a touch of cervicogenic dizziness.

I’m currently on lamotrigine and venlafaxine which have been life-savers for me. My nystagmus has also reduced significantly.

At the time that I was writing this post, I really wasn’t sure which came first—the nystagmus or the migraine, but I am realizing that the migraine-induced dizziness was causing all of my other problems.

The only thing that I’m kind of worried about going forward is that my nervous system is kind of shot. I basically abuse my nervous system over the years by constantly being in a state of stress I decided to take a leave of absence for my job to temporarily be a stay at home mom. I’m a little bit apprehensive about going back to my teaching job because it is so high stress.
